WebConstant Criticism and Scrutiny. As President, you are constantly under scrutiny from the media and the public. Every action you take is analyzed and criticized, and you are held accountable for your mistakes. This can be overwhelming and stressful. Being the President of a country is a challenging job that comes with many rewards and difficulties.
